As the food with the highest safety level, organic food has been quite popular since it entered the Chinese market in the 1990s. Even though it later appeared in supermarkets and even organic food stores, the high price still prevented it from entering ordinary people's homes. The insiders who were the first to eat the "organic food" crab in China have complained more than once: "The government and the media are in full swing in the publicity of environmental protection and health, and our promotional materials have been distributed batch after batch, but the people in the supermarket rarely copy the organic food without hesitation." Their reason is also a high sounding one: "I can buy a kilo of rice from you, and I can buy a bag of rice from the vegetable market. Besides, these two bags of rice are just the same. I want to cheat customers to spend more money. I don't want to be such a big enemy." "However, great changes have taken place in recent years." Guo Chunmin, senior engineer of China Green Food Development Center and executive deputy director of China Green Huaxia Organic Food Certification Center, said, "With the enhancement of people's health and environmental awareness, organic food has been popular. Like vegetarian food, it has become a synonym for healthy eating." Today, there are a variety of organic foods in the market. Organic rice, organic tea, organic fruits and vegetables, and organic beverages have occupied a place. Organic food stores in various forms have opened one by one. More and more white-collar workers, pregnant women, and new mothers regard organic food as a key word in their lives, and group purchasing and group consumption also favor it. Ms. Yang, who is purchasing gifts for her company, said: "Since organic food is good for health, it doesn't matter if it is expensive."
It is worrying that the good and bad are intermingled
On April 1, 2005, China implemented the national standards and corresponding regulations for organic products - "Formulation of national standards for organic products" and "Measures for the Administration of Organic Product Certification". Yang Zhifeng, general manager of Shenzhen Ruililai Industry Co., Ltd., told the reporter that although the country has a very standardized and strict standard for the certification of organic food in China, driven by the interests, some enterprises will have some non-standard behaviors in order to save costs after passing the organic food certification standard, such as failing to regulate the production and processing of organic food in strict accordance with the organic food standard, Some enterprises even pass ordinary food processed by ordinary agricultural products off as organic food.
The disunity of organic food certification marks on the market and the exposure of non-standard behaviors of some organic food production and marketing enterprises have led consumers to the idea of "being afraid to buy fake products at high prices". Even if they know the benefits of organic food, they dare not buy it easily, which makes the current sales of organic food not optimistic. Relevant people have provided such data. The total sales of organic food in China only account for 0.03% of the food sales, which is nearly 100 times higher than the level of 2% in developed countries.
In view of the above problems and concerns in the domestic organic food market, experts suggest that the government can make full use of its social credibility to vigorously promote organic healthy food to the public, for example, not only to expose some food problems, but also to tell the public what food is safe to eat, and promote organic food to the public to actively integrate with the international food market.
Continue to follow the road of business supermarket
The author learned from people in the organic food industry in Beijing and Shenzhen that there are generally three ways to sell organic food in supermarkets and shopping malls in China:
The most common is that organic food enterprises directly put their products on the shelves of large supermarkets and shopping malls for sale. For example, the organic rice series of Guangzhou "Keyu" have appeared on the shelves of Friendship, Jizhidao, Guangbai and Xindaxin in Guangzhou in recent years, which has greatly improved the popularity of their products.
Another is cooperative sales. Organic food enterprises provide organic products to some large supermarkets and sell them in the supermarket with supermarket brands. Supermarkets have a strict and standardized process in the selection of organic food cooperative enterprises. During the whole cooperation process, the production, processing and transportation of organic food of the cooperative enterprises should be comprehensively tested for many times. Only when each link fully meets the organic standards can cooperative sales be carried out. Shenzhen "Ruililai" and Wal Mart cooperate to sell 12 varieties of organic food, mainly organic miscellaneous grains.
The last one is the organic special area sales of supermarkets and shopping malls. There is a special area in the supermarket to sell organic food, with complete brands and varieties. This method is popular abroad. It is reported that Wal Mart in the United States has a large organic food sales area, which has a wide range of vegetables and fruits to cereals. According to insiders, Wal Mart in Shenzhen has recently opened a similar organic food sales area in its store.
As the development of the domestic organic food market is relatively slow compared with that of foreign countries, some small and medium-sized organic food enterprises can continue to focus on the supermarket sales strategy in the domestic market, which can not only accumulate funds for future development, but also improve the popularity and strength of enterprises and brands.
